What is Play Therapy?
Through play, therapists can help children learn more adaptive behaviour in situations where the child presents emotional or social deficits.

I am a psychologist, sensory integration therapist and Play Therapy therapist, supervisor and trainer. I take a holistic approach to child therapy taking into account the child's mental, emotional, physical needs, taking into account the environment in which they live. My special interest is directed towards play therapy. Participation in numerous trainings, workshops and conferences enables me to integrate ideas from different approaches in child therapy.

I am a member of Play Therapy International, the Polish Psychological Association, the American Psychological Association and the Polish Sensory Integration Association. I work in accordance with their Codes of Ethics. My work is continuously and regularly supervised by supervisors certified by Play Therapy International
